The sex chromosome present in males of species in which the male is the heterogametic sex; generally, the sex chromosome that pairs with the X chromosome in the heterogametic sex. The Y chromosome is absent from the cells of females and present in one copy in the somatic cells of males. A chromosome involved in sex determination. A structure composed of a very long molecule of DNA and associated proteins (e.g. histones) that carries hereditary information.
